scripts: add scriptutils module
Add a utility module for scripts. This is intended to provide functions only really useful before bitbake has been found (or only of particular interest to scripts). At the moment this includes functions for setting up a logger and for loading plugins. +import sys
+import os
+import logging
+import glob
+
+def logger_create(name):
+ logger = logging.getLogger(name)
+ loggerhandler = logging.StreamHandler()
+ loggerhandler.setFormatter(logging.Formatter("%(levelname)s: %(message)s"))
+ logger.addHandler(loggerhandler)
+ logger.setLevel(logging.INFO)
+ return logger
+
+def logger_setup_color(logger, color='auto'):
+ from bb.msg import BBLogFormatter
+ console = logging.StreamHandler(sys.stdout)
+ formatter = BBLogFormatter("%(levelname)s: %(message)s")
+ console.setFormatter(formatter)
+ logger.handlers = [console]
+ if color == 'always' or (color=='auto' and console.stream.isatty()):
+ formatter.enable_color()
+
+
+def load_plugins(logger, plugins, pluginpath):
+ import imp
+
+ def load_plugin(name):
+ logger.debug('Loading plugin %s' % name)
+ fp, pathname, description = imp.find_module(name, [pluginpath])
+ try:
+ return imp.load_module(name, fp, pathname, description)
+ finally:
+ if fp:
+ fp.close()
+
+ logger.debug('Loading plugins from %s...' % pluginpath)
+ for fn in glob.glob(os.path.join(pluginpath, '*.py')):
+ name = os.path.splitext(os.path.basename(fn))[0]
+ if name != '__init__':
+ plugin = load_plugin(name)
+ if hasattr(plugin, 'plugin_init'):
+ plugin.plugin_init(plugins)
+ plugins.append(plugin)
